Cichla ocellaris, sometimes known as the butterfly peacock bass ("peacock bass" is also used for some of its relatives ), is a very large species of cichlid from South America, and a prized game fish. It reaches 74 cm (29 in) in length. [2] It is native to the Marowijne and Essequibo drainages in the Guianas, and the Branco ...
